    Strawberry Tart With Homemade Nutella

    Make this easy no bake Strawberry Tart With Homemade Nutella when you have a sweet tooth. It's sweet and delicious! (Vegan, Paleo, Gluten-free).

    This dessert is just that, pure indulgence! And yes, it does taste as good as it looks! On top of a delicious  no-bake almond/pecan crust you get a smooth layer of creamy homemade Nutella topped with fresh strawberries. This dessert is also great when topped with fresh coconut whipping cream.

    As with everything else I make, this recipe for Strawberry Tart With Homemade Nutella contain no grains or gluten, it is free of refined sugars and it is also paleo approved. ENJOY!

    Servings :8 (2 5-inch pies)
    Prep :35 mins
    Prevent your screen from going dark

    Ingredients

    Tart Crust:

    • ½ cup dates
    • ½ cup blanched almond flour
    • ⅓ cup pecans, chopped
    • ½ teaspoon vanilla extract

    Homemade Nutella:

    • 1 cup hazelnut butter, recipe here
    • 3 tablespoons semisweet mini chocolate chips
    • 2 tablespoons full fat coconut milk, or heavy cream
    • 2 tablespoons raw cacao powder
    • 3 tablespoons coconut oil, melted
    • 1 tablespoon unrefined coconut sugar
    • ½ teaspoon vanilla extract
    • pinch fine himalayan salt
    • 1 cup fresh strawberries

    Instructions
     

    Crust:

    • Remove pit from dates and process in a food processor until it forms a creamy paste.
    • In a bowl, mix the date paste, almond flour, chopped pecans and vanilla (I mixed ingredients by hand) and spread the mixture on the bottom of two 4.75-inch removable bottom tart pans.

    Homemade Nutella:

    • Make the hazelnut butter according to this recipe.
    • Melt the chocolate chips in a double boiler over simmering water.
    • Stir in the coconut milk, raw cacao powder, coconut oil, coconut sugar, vanilla and salt.
    • Pour the nutella on top of the crust and top with fresh strawberries.

    Notes

    Recipe makes two 4.75 inch tarts and you will have some leftover Nutella (can't complain about that, right?). Cover and store in the refrigerator.

    Nutrition per serving

    Calories: 383.4kcalProtein: 7.4gFat: 33.2gSaturated Fat: 8.4gSugar: 11.8gFiber: 5.8gCarbohydrates: 20.5gNet Carbs: 14.7g
